Legendary cricket broadcaster, Henry Blofeld, takes readers on a charming journey through modern cricket, while looking back at the great games of yesteryear.
Henry has been close to the heart of cricket for over fifty years. He has seen the game grow into a hugely international sport, where franchises continue to have massive influence and more and more games are added to the world calendar. It wasn't always this way and Blowers reflects on how cricket used to be and where it is headed.
In this new book he explores the big shifts, innovations and challenges facing the game today, while looking back at his life and career, recounting his cherished memories of his beloved sport. With his signature wit and insight, he compared the cricketing landscape of today with the cherished memories of yesteryear.
Henry Blofeld
The bubbly, boisterous world of Blowers knows no full stops. He is best known as a cricket commentator on BBC Radio 4's Test Match Special and BBC Radio 5 Live. He even occasionally turns up on Channel 4's 'Countdown' programme and is an amusing after dinner speaker. His idiosyncratic form of commentary is unique. His one-man shows have sold out across the UK, including the Royal Albert Hall. His stories about Ian Fleming, Noel Coward, Clive Dunn and others have brought the house down.
